The Museum is a two minute walk from Eton College Chapel in South Meadow Lane. On Sunday afternoon there is free on-road parking available on Eton Wick Road and in South Meadow Lane, a short walk away.
The Museum is a 15 minute walk from Windsor and Eton Riverside and 20 minutes from Windsor and Eton Central. From Slough Station take bus number 60 towards Eton.
